Korean folklore is well established, going back several thousand years. The folklore's basis derives from a variety of belief systems, including Shamanism, Confucianism, Buddhism and more recently Christianity.[1] Mythical creatures often abound in the tales, including the Korean conception of goblins[Dokkaebi (Korean: 도깨비)]. Korean folklore began to be organized after folklore lectures were started by Cho-Chi hun.[2] It is still deeply embedded in Korean society. It appears deeply in the fields of religion, story, art, custom, etc.
